No, there is no direct train from Lowestoft to Wembley. However, there are services departing from Lowestoft station and arriving at Wembley station via Norwich.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 47m.
Lowestoft to Wembley train services, operated by Greater Anglia, depart from Lowestoft station.
Lowestoft to Wembley train services, operated by Greater Anglia, arrive at London Liverpool Street station.
The distance between Lowestoft and Wembley is 173.7 km. The road distance is 238 km.
